Transaction 25eb41b82c5ce4d2de5a68255ca0eff74fd2d8dd87177ed8732aec08f006afda

118 Input
2 Outputs
  • 25eb41b82c5ce4d2de5a68255ca0eff74fd2d8dd87177ed8732aec08f006afda:0
  • value  439668121
    address  3NLH8vSETySe1cBSswMfwUHPJmmPJszDRc
  • 25eb41b82c5ce4d2de5a68255ca0eff74fd2d8dd87177ed8732aec08f006afda:1
  • value  1096527
    address  39fsweJaibmXqjio5QNi5KTsHivkaxXpNb